Skip to content

Commit

Permalink
test decoders split up and try except in uwyo for Azure
Browse files Browse the repository at this point in the history
  • Loading branch information
Greg Blumberg committed Jan 12, 2019
1 parent 7b513fa commit cc2e6b0
Showing 1 changed file with 15 additions and 10 deletions.
25 changes: 15 additions & 10 deletions sharppy/tests/test_decoders.py
Original file line number Diff line number Diff line change
@@ -1,3 +1,4 @@
import pytest
import sharppy.io.decoder as decoder
import sharppy.io.buf_decoder as buf_decoder
import sharppy.io.spc_decoder as spc_decoder
Expand All @@ -11,12 +12,11 @@
'examples/data/oun_uwyo.html',
'examples/data/ABR.txt',
'examples/data/OUN.txt']

def test_decoder():

decoders = decoder.getDecoders()
assert len(decoders) > 0


decoders = decoder.getDecoders()
assert len(decoders) > 0

def test_spc_decoder():
dec = spc_decoder.SPCDecoder(files[0])
profs = dec.getProfiles()
profs._backgroundCopy("")
Expand All @@ -40,7 +40,8 @@ def test_decoder():
profs.modify(-999, tmpc=tmp, idx_range=[0,1])
profs.resetModification('tmpc')
profs.resetModification('u')


def test_bufkit_decoder():
# Load in a BUFKIT file
dec = buf_decoder.BufDecoder(files[1])
profs = dec.getProfiles()
Expand All @@ -51,10 +52,15 @@ def test_decoder():
assert profs.isModified() == False
assert profs.getAnalogDate() is None
assert profs.hasCurrentProf() == True


def test_uwyo_decoder():
# Try to load in the UWYO file
#dec = uwyo_decoder.UWYODecoder(files[2])
try:
dec = uwyo_decoder.UWYODecoder(files[2])
except:
print("FAILED")

def test_pecan_decoder():
# Load in the PECAN-type files
dec = pecan_decoder.PECANDecoder(files[3])
dec = pecan_decoder.PECANDecoder(files[4])
Expand All @@ -68,4 +74,3 @@ def test_decoder():
profs.advanceTime(-1)
#print(profs)

#test_decoder()

0 comments on commit cc2e6b0

Please sign in to comment.